What Gas Really Is
On Ethereum, gas is measured in “gwei,” a fraction of ETH, tiny but powerful. To send money, mint an NFT, or run a smart contract, you must spend gas. It is not unlike the price of fuel for a car, or the market boy’s fee for his barrow: it rewards those who keep things moving.
Validators — the invisible workers of the blockchain — confirm and secure every transaction. Gas fees pay them. Without this, the network would collapse, overwhelmed by chaos and noise.
Why the Price Changes
But, like the market, the cost of passage is never stable. At noon, when the crowd surges, you pay more. At dusk, when the stalls are closing, the way is cheaper.
Gas fees rise when too many people demand access at once. A simple transaction is light, like carrying a small basket of oranges. But deploying a smart contract is heavy, like hauling a sack of yams — and the cost reflects it.

Learning to Adapt
And yet, as with every system, people find ways to adapt. Some wait for quieter hours. Others migrate to gentler paths — Layer 2 networks like Polygon, Arbitrum — where the cost of passage is lower.
